Aller au contenu

jjacques68

Membres confirmés
  • Compteur de contenus

    4 364
  • Inscription

  • Dernière visite

  • Jours gagnés

    39

Tout ce qui a été posté par jjacques68

  1. pour alim aussi ? et tout ça fois 3 façades !
  2. et puis redescendre jusqu'à l'ipx à la cave, et faire remonté l'alim 24 V ! Pffffiiouuu !!
  3. jjacques68

    time et variable local

    tu peux faire un debug de la variable newora1 ?
  4. celuici serait pas mal, mais pas le prix ! Mais comment le faire communiquer avec la HC2 sans fil ??? et son alim ??
  5. il me semble qu’on peut régler la vitesse du dimmer dans ses paramètres ! Dans les 10 premier il me semble... faut tester... https://manuals.fibaro.com/content/manuals/en/FGD-212/FGD-212-EN-T-v1.3.pdf
  6. jjacques68

    time et variable local

    newora1 contient des secondes ?
  7. jjacques68

    time et variable local

    oui alors tu risques de ne pas le voir passer, 2 secondes est trop court, le Main d'un VD tourne toutes les 3 secondes environs. Il te faut une boule qui tourne toutes les secondes ! Faudrait passer par une scène et fixer le setTimeout de la boucle à 1s.
  8. jjacques68

    time et variable local

    Mais attention si ces lignes sont dans un setTimeout, il faut que le temps de bouclage soit <= à ces 2 secondes !! Sinon tu risques de ne pas les voir passer !
  9. jjacques68

    time et variable local

    c'est censé marché.
  10. En tout cas ça remarche, mais pas grâce à moi. J'ai absolument rien fait. A noté que ça me le faisait que pour ce site...
  11. c'est pénible ! J'ai essayé avec un setTimeout au lieu du sleep et change rien. Je me suis dit qu'avant d'écrire dans la VGSend, j'allais lire le contenu de cette variable, et ajouter la nouvelle à la précédente, et change rien non plus. Je sais pas si c'est le VD qui rame ou l'écriture de la VG...
  12. jjacques68

    time et variable local

    de rien...
  13. nan ça change rien avec l'ID... voici le code de ma scène : --[[ %% properties %% events %% globals VDSoleilAzimut WifiOn PatrolCave PatrolSalon PatrolEtage --]] local MonMessage = "VG;" local MaVg = fibaro:getSourceTrigger().varName MonMessage = MonMessage..MaVg..";"..tonumber(fibaro:getGlobalValue(MaVg))..";" fibaro:setGlobal("SendDisplayVg", MonMessage) fibaro:call(559,"pressButton", 1) print(MonMessage) et celui du bouton du VD : local udpSocket = Net.FUdpSocket() local ToSend = fibaro:getGlobalValue("SendDisplayVg") local Ip = fibaro:getGlobalValue("DisplayIp") if ToSend ~= "" then fibaro:debug(ToSend) udpSocket:write(ToSend,Ip,9503) end on peut pas faire plus simple je pense... Donc si les 3 VG Patrolxxxxx changent au même moment, c'est là que je perds la "synchro"
  14. jjacques68

    time et variable local

    marrant comme les messages se croisent
  15. jjacques68

    time et variable local

    moi perso je ferais : if fibaro:getValue(fibaro:getSelfId(),"ui.Label5.value") == "Prog_1" then fibaro:call(fibaro:getSelfId(), "setProperty", "ui.lblTime2.value", "Bonjour") end Je ne connais pas le getProperty...
  16. jjacques68

    time et variable local

  17. jjacques68

    time et variable local

    et puis c’est pas getValue plutôt ?
  18. jjacques68

    time et variable local

    tu as mis getProperty dans la condition au lieu de setProperty
  19. arrête, je l’utilise souvent pour empêcher qu’il y ait trop d’instaces... bon j’essaye après
  20. euh... oups... c’est pas obligé si ?
  21. c’est bête mais j’ai commencé à flipper : piratage ou autre... du coup j’ai débranché l’adsl toute la nuit et gardé la 4G
  22. pas testé avec nslookup, pas pensé mon FAI = bouygues. pas de code erreur, mais il disait juste qu’il ne pouvait pas établir une connexion sécurisé. et rien d’autre ??
  23. ça ne pouvait pas être ça, car j’avais le même soucis sur l’ipad, et là... pas de kaspersky...
  24. hello tout le monde ! petite question... vous explique mon cas : j’ai une scène toute simple avec comme trigger 3 VG (VG1, VG2, VG3) cette scène met la valeur et le nom de la VG déclencheuse dans une autre VG (VGSend) et actionne un bouton dans un VD. Ce bouton envoie le contenu de la VGSend vers une socket. Cette trame est analysée par un soft, ... bref ça c’est ok. quand la scène est déclenchée par une seule VG, c’est nickel. le soft reçoit la trame avec le nom et la valeur. MAIS : si la scène est déclenchée 2 ou 3 fois quasi instantanément (à cause du changement de valeur des VG simultanément) la çà pose problème. la scène est bien triggée 3 fois je le vois dans le débug. Le bouton du VD est bien actionnée 3 fois (visible dans le debug), mais la valeur de la VGSend n’est pas toujours à jour dans le VD. je sais pas si vous voyez ce que je veux dire, mais on dirait que la VGSend met plus de temps à se mettre à jours que l’excution du script de la scène et du VD. Resultat, je me retrouve avec 3 trames sur la socket, mais avec des valeurs en double, par exemple 2 fois la VG1, voir des fois 3 fois. j’ai tenté de ne pas passer par la VGSend, mais directement par un label de mon VD, mais c’est pire. j’ai tenté de temporiser l’exécution de la scène avec un sleep(500) dès le début de la scène, mais ça change rien. j’ai même tenté de mettre fibaro:sleep(fibaro:countScenes()*500) pour que chaque instance de la scène soit retardée en fonction du nombre..., mais toujours rien. alors je sèche... comment comprendre ce qu’il se passe ? comment y remédier ? une solution idéale serait d’envoyer sur la socket depuis la scène, mais il me semble que ce n’est pas possible... merci à vous !!
  25. on dirait que c’est revenu à la normal...
×
×
  • Créer...